SP Group (SP) signed an agreement with Saigon Beer Alcohol Beverage Corporation (SABECO) to install 10.44MWp of rooftop solar panels across its nine factories in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am.  To be operational by Q3 of 2023, the project will provide close to 25 per cent of electricity consumed at the factories. The system will deliver over 14,600 MWh of electricity per year, enough to power more than 4,000 households in Vietnam. This is equivalent to reducing carbon emissions by close to 10,000 tonnes annually.

The partnership with SABECO is the latest in SP’s plan to undertake 1.5GW of utility scale and rooftop solar projects in Vietnam by 2025.
